prompt-pro

prompt-pro appears to be a course/materials repository focused on teaching prompt engineering and context engineering for business users, including frameworks, examples, and segment content that mentions MCP and agentic AI concepts. The included manifest indicates only a minimal Node.js demo dependency on the OpenAI SDK, but no concrete API surface is described in the provided README.

Best When

You want educational content and prompt templates/frameworks to train humans or to bootstrap internal prompt practices.

Avoid When

You need a documented REST/GraphQL/gRPC interface (with authentication, rate limits, and error codes) that an agent can call directly.

Use Cases

  • Learning prompt engineering and context engineering patterns for business workflows
  • Using prompt templates (e.g., CRAFT) as starting points for structured outputs
  • Understanding agentic AI concepts and how MCP relates to agent tooling (as educational material)
  • Adapting course segment materials for internal training or enablement

Not For

  • A production-ready API/service for programmatic prompt/template delivery
  • A turnkey autonomous agent platform with documented endpoints and operational guarantees
  • Use as an authoritative source for security or compliance claims about third-party AI platforms
